In interviews, are you nervous when introducing yourself and don’t quite know what’s the right thing to say? 🥶
Do you ramble on and on and feel like the interviewer is losing interest but don’t know how to stop? 🤐
Do you finish an interview frustrated with yourself and don’t know why you did so poorly even though you spent hours preparing? 😔
Interviews are hard, especially for introverts. Social interactions drain an introvert's energy, and high-stakes interactions like interviews put us center-stage with the spotlight 🔦on us and our work, making us even more nervous and uncomfortable.
Most designers I've coached are introverts; amazing at their craft but struggle to perform when interviewing. As a result, they get passed over even though they would have been perfect for the role.
For 18 years as a designer and design leader, I've been in hundreds of interviews as interviewer and interviewee. I've seen first hand what works (and what doesn't).
During the 2020 covid and 2023 tech layoffs, I've coached introverts (like me) to practice easy-to-apply techniques that helped them approach interviews more confidently, and get hired. All while remaining their true, authentic selves.
